10x Banking, the cloud-native core banking platform, has been recognized as a ‘Luminary’ in Celent’s latest Next-Gen Core Banking Platforms report for mid-large banks. This accolade places 10x in the top right quadrant of Celent’s evaluation matrix, signifying excellence across technology, functionality, and client experience. The report assessed 13 next-gen core banking providers, highlighting 10x’s advanced capabilities and strong performance in supporting large financial institutions.

Industry Comments
Daniel Mayo, a Celent analyst, praised the platform’s capabilities, stating:
“The 10x Banking platform is a secure, reliable, scalable, and microservices-based cloud-native core banking platform that provides a flexible product design and processing fabric to support the complex needs of the largest banks.”
Lewis Ide, Vice President at 10x Banking, emphasized the company’s mission and future goals, saying:
“10x Banking’s mission is to create technology that helps banks deliver better experiences for their customers. This focus has been recognized by Celent, naming 10x a Luminary for mid-large banks. 2024 was a pivotal year for us with the launch of the ‘meta core,’ paving the way for deeper collaboration with our customers. The year ahead will focus on supporting banks as they modernize their core systems, ensuring they can meet customer needs at scale and speed.”

3. What types of banks benefit from 10x’s platform?
Celent classifies mid-large banks as tier 1-4 institutions with over $20 billion in assets. These banks often have complex legacy architectures and require a high level of customization and scalability, which 10x’s platform provides.
